PROCEDURE

实验过程

A flask with stir bar and nitrogen line was charged with sodium hydride (60 wt % in oil, 0.212 g, 5.31 mmol) and DMSO (9 mL) then the mixture was warmed in an oil bath heated to about 65° C. for about 1 h. The mixture was cooled to rt, diluted with THF (18 mL) then cooled to about 0° C. Trimethylsulfonium iodide (1.084 g, 5.31 mmol) was added then the mixture was stirred for about 15 min. rac-(4aR,12bR)-12b-Ethyl-9-(4-fluorophenyl)-1,4,4a,5,6,7,9,12b-octahydrobenzo[6,7]cyclohepta[1,2-f]indazole-3 (2H)-one (9, R1=4-Fluorophenyl, R2=Ethyl) (0.800 g, 2.125 mmol) was added in one portion then the mixture was stirred and allowed to warm to rt. After stirring overnight the mixture was concentrated under reduced pressure to remove THF. The mixture was partitioned between water (50 mL) and EtOAc (50 mL). The aqueous layer was extracted with EtOAc (25 mL). The combined organics were washed with water (2×25 mL) then brine (25 mL), dried over MgSO4, then filtered. The filtrate was concentrated under reduced pressure then the material was purified on silica gel (40 g) using 0-10% EtOAc in DCM. Product fractions containing the epoxide isomer with the higher Rf (TLC, 95:5 DCM/EtOAc, vis by UV) were collected and concentrated under reduced pressure to yield rac-(2′R,4aR,12bR)-12b-ethyl-9-(4-fluorophenyl)-2,4,4a,5,6,7,9,12b-octahydro-1H-spiro[benzo[6,7]cyclohepta[1,2-f]indazole-3,2′-oxirane] (154, R1=4-Fluorophenyl, R2=Ethyl) (0.308 g, 37.1%); LC/MS, method 3, Rt=2.94 min, MS m/z 391 (M+H)+. 1H NMR (400 MHz, DMSO) δ 8.26 (d, J=0.8 Hz, 1H), 7.89 (s, 1H), 7.84-7.77 (m, 2H), 7.56 (s, 1H), 7.45-7.36 (m, 2H), 3.26-3.18 (m, 1H), 2.97-2.92 (m, 1H), 2.61-2.54 (m, 2H), 2.24-2.15 (m, 1H), 2.03-1.71 (m, 8H), 1.62-1.58 (m, 1H), 1.39-1.21 (m, 2H), 1.06-1.01 (m, 1H), 0.40 (t, J=7.3 Hz, 3H).
